The National Composites Centre is recruiting for a Procurement Apprentice to start in January 2026. This is a great opportunity to begin a career in Purchasing/Procurement, with pathways into Finance or Project Management.

How the Apprenticeship Works:

You’ll embark on up to two years of learning - 18 months of study + 6-month end-point assessment. During the first 18 months, you will complete the CIPS Level 3 Advanced Certificate.

The apprenticeship is graded pass, distinction, or fail based on the end-point assessment. Completion of the Advanced Certificate is required before the final assessment.

What You Can Expect to Be Doing:

  • Study CIPS Procurement and Supply Assistant Apprenticeship Level 3, gaining fundamental knowledge and skills.
  • Assist Category Leads with drafting tender documents, running supplier competitions, and evaluating responses.
  • Gain hands-on experience in contract negotiations, supporting senior team members and leading certain activities.
  • Monitor supplier performance, generate reports, and ensure contract compliance.
  • Help maintain records, track negotiations, and update contracts and correspondence.
  • Identify risks in the procurement process, ensuring the best outcomes for the business.
  • Use the ERP system for processing requisitions, raising orders, and onboarding new suppliers.
  • Engage with stakeholders across the business to support procurement activities.
  • Source new suppliers, conduct market research, and stay updated on industry trends.
  • Attend meetings, collaborate with teams, and support the drafting of import/export requirements and contracts.

Programme Overview:

(Topics sequence may vary)

  • Procurement & Supply Environments
  • Ethical Procurement & Supply
  • Contract Administration
  • Team Dynamics & Change
  • Socially Responsible Warehousing & Distribution

How Will You Be Learning?

  • The programme will be delivered at our Bristol Filton site (SGS College, Filton Campus). Start date at the NCC, Emerson’s Green, Bristol, will be in early January 2026, a few weeks ahead of the apprenticeship programme beginning mid-January 2026, to familiarise yourself with the NCC first.
  • The apprenticeship blends theoretical learning with practical workplace application.
  • The programme includes three main phases:
    • Foundations: Essential industry knowledge.
    • Development: Skill-building through practical experience.
    • Final Assessment: A project and formal evaluation to demonstrate competence.
  • Apprentices will gain critical thinking, problem-solving, and project management skills, preparing them for real-world challenges.

Work-Based Commitment:

You will spend 20% of your working week in college and engaging in off-the-job training activities, such as shadowing or participating in relevant meetings.

Assessment:

  • The CIPS qualification includes 5 multiple-choice exams at the end of each module (remote or in-person).
  • End-point assessment (EPA): A 3000-word work-based project, presenting solutions to a business issue, followed by a presentation and professional discussion based on your portfolio.

Qualification:

Level 3 Procurement & Supply Assistant Apprenticeship (Includes Level 3 CIPS Certificate) see more details about this qualification here

About The Company

NCC is a world-leading innovation organisation that turns cutting-edge research and technology into industrial impact. We bridge the gap between academia and industry, helping companies of all sizes to capitalise on cutting-edge innovation to deliver more. We do this at every stage of their journey from the earliest concept to end-of-life.
